<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<!-- $Revision$ -->
<refentry xml:id="function.dbase-replace-record" xmlns="http://docbook.org/ns/docbook">
 <refnamediv>
  <refname>dbase_replace_record</refname>
  <refpurpose>Replaces a record in a database</refpurpose>
 </refnamediv>
 <refsect1 role="description">
  &reftitle.description;
  <methodsynopsis>
   <type>bool</type><methodname>dbase_replace_record</methodname>
   <methodparam><type>resource</type><parameter>database</parameter></methodparam>
   <methodparam><type>array</type><parameter>data</parameter></methodparam>
   <methodparam><type>int</type><parameter>number</parameter></methodparam>
  </methodsynopsis>
  <para>
   Replaces the given record in the database with the given data.
  </para>
 </refsect1>
 <refsect1 role="parameters">
  &reftitle.parameters;
  <para>
   <variablelist>
    <varlistentry>
     <term><parameter>database</parameter></term>
     <listitem>
      <para>
       The database resource, returned by <function>dbase_open</function>
       or <function>dbase_create</function>.
      </para>
     </listitem>
    </varlistentry>
    <varlistentry>
     <term><parameter>data</parameter></term>
     <listitem>
      <para>
       An indexed array of data. The number of items must be equal to the
       number of fields in the database, otherwise
       <function>dbase_replace_record</function> will fail.
      </para>
      <note>
       <para>
        If you're using <function>dbase_get_record</function> return value for this
        parameter, remember to reset the key named <literal>deleted</literal>.
       </para>
      </note>
     </listitem>
    </varlistentry>
    <varlistentry>
     <term><parameter>number</parameter></term>
     <listitem>
      <para>
       An integer which spans from 1 to the number of records in the database
       (as returned by <function>dbase_numrecords</function>).
      </para>
     </listitem>
    </varlistentry>
   </variablelist>
  </para>
 </refsect1>
 <refsect1 role="returnvalues">
  &reftitle.returnvalues;
  <para>
   &return.success;
  </para>
 </refsect1>

 <refsect1 role="changelog">
  &reftitle.changelog;
  <informaltable>
   <tgroup cols="2">
    <thead>
     <row>
      <entry>&Version;</entry>
      <entry>&Description;</entry>
     </row>
    </thead>
    <tbody>
     <row>
      <entry>PECL dbase 7.0.0</entry>
      <entry>
       <parameter>database</parameter> is now a <type>resource</type>
       instead of an <type>int</type>.
      </entry>
     </row>
    </tbody>
   </tgroup>
  </informaltable>
 </refsect1>

 <refsect1 role="examples">
  &reftitle.examples;
  <para>
   <example>
    <title>Updating a record in the database</title>
    <programlisting role="php">
<![CDATA[
<?php

// open in read-write mode
$db = dbase_open('/tmp/test.dbf', 2);

if ($db) {
  // gets the old row
  $row = dbase_get_record_with_names($db, 1);
  
  // remove the 'deleted' entry
  unset($row['deleted']);
  
  // Update the date field with the current timestamp
  $row['date'] = date('Ymd');
  
  // convert the row to an indexed array
  $row = array_values($row);

  // Replace the record
  dbase_replace_record($db, $row, 1);
  dbase_close($db);
}

?>
]]>
    </programlisting>
   </example>
  </para>
 </refsect1>

 <refsect1 role="notes"><!-- {{{ -->
  &reftitle.notes;
  <note>
   <para>
    Boolean fields result in an <type>int</type> element value
    (<literal>0</literal> or <literal>1</literal>) when retrieved via
    <function>dbase_get_record</function> or
    <function>dbase_get_record_with_names</function>. If they are written back,
    this results in the value becoming <literal>0</literal>, so care has to be
    taken to properly adjust the values.
   </para>
  </note>
 </refsect1><!-- }}} -->

 <refsect1 role="seealso">
  &reftitle.seealso;
  <para>
   <simplelist>
    <member><function>dbase_add_record</function></member>
    <member><function>dbase_delete_record</function></member>
   </simplelist>
  </para>
 </refsect1>
</refentry>
